Steps
-
Wash and blanch peanuts in boiling water
-
Pour into the pot with oil and stir-fry over low heat
-
It takes 1 minute after you hear crackling sounds in the pot. Take it out and put it on a plate
-
Put 50 grams of sugar in a pot, add 2 tablespoons of water and simmer over low heat
-
When foaming, add peanuts, turn off heat and stir-fry
-
Let each peanut be coated with sugar water and stir-fry
-
When it gets cold, it turns into frost, and the longevity fruit is born
